Primary Machine Setting
F8.00Local communication address: Set this address to 0 and make the inverter
as a host.
F8.01Communication configure: Set all the data formats of the inverter to the
same value.
Secondary Machine Setting
F0.01Selection of frequency setting: Set this value to 3, the frequency will be
set by COM (serial communication).
F0.04
Selection of operating instruction: Set this value to "2", the inverter will
be controlled by COM.
F8.00Local communication address: Set this address to 1~30, which means 30
sets of inverters can be connected at this address maximally).
F8.01Communication configure: Remain the same as the primary machine.
F8.02Communication timed-out checkout time: Remain the same as the primary
machine.
F8.03Local response delay: Remain the same as the primary machine
F8.04Interlocking setting ratio: 0.01~10.00, set as per user's demand.
Only such operations can be done on the master inverter, such as start, stop and
so the like. Other operations should be matched with the master inverter.
